Explain the reasons for the Kansas-Nebraska Act

Respuesta :

mrsedlack
mrsedlack mrsedlack
  • 14-02-2019

The Kansas/Nebraska Act was passed as the loggerhead over slavery in Kansas and Nebraska was preventing a railroad from being built.

Senator Douglas and President Pierce drafted the bill and signed it to allow for the passage of the Transcontinental Railroad
